Output 0d96fba662d8c995fb87130fe049176a4fe61bb14f3468eeb04300b9c9e2f5b9:57

value
65287000
script pubkey
OP_0 OP_PUSHBYTES_32 ca623960d80bfe7aa0c3af47fd99fc7bf24f873592dc36ea12ea3aea3060c223
address
bc1qef3rjcxcp0l84gxr4arlmx0u00eylpe4jtwrd6sjagaw5vrqcg3s0u53m2
transaction
0d96fba662d8c995fb87130fe049176a4fe61bb14f3468eeb04300b9c9e2f5b9